Information on How to Clean Natural Stone
There are five ways to clean natural stone that you can do one by one. All of the methods given require tools. Starting from tools that are easily found at home to high pressure cleaners. In addition, there is information about the types of natural stones based on how they are cleaned as well.
1. Rubbed with Water
The first way to clean natural stones is scrubbed with water. This method is among the easiest and fastest. You only need to scrub the stone with a brush and a cleaning liquid such as soap / detergent. Stubborn dirt that is able to get rid of the maximum in this way. Please note that this method is much more effective for the andesite stone type alone.

3. Maximizing Sandpaper
There are several soft types of natural stones that do not require special cleaning fluids in the cleaning process. On the other hand, just maximize the sandpaper that is easy to find at this time. You can use sandpaper to get in the way of weathering and cleaning.
Rub sandpaper onto weathered surfaces. If it is perfect, wash the stone with a soft sponge so that the surface is not damaged. This method needs to be done so that the appearance of the stone still looks good and decent.
4. Using a Wire / Brass Brush
Natural stone which has a rough surface and large pores can be cleaned effectively by rubbing. For a more complete scrubbing, use a wire or brass brush. The dirt stuck to the natural stone can be removed more easily with the help of cleaning fluids as well.
Conversely, if the natural stone is considered smooth and soft, use a plastic bristle brush. If you use a wire / brass brush, the result can actually damage the surface of the natural stone.
